|
Experience Pollux - Microsoft .Net
In Pollux sees its mission as helping businesses to take advantage of .NET value propositions: better integration, cross-platform compatibility, and lower IT costs.
To stay abreast of ever evolving field of technology, Pollux has been following the developments by Microsoft via our R&D team. As a result, the company has
been involved with Microsoft .NET from grounds up and has accumulated rich experience
now in .net based project execution. The focus is on helping the clients with planning,
migration, development, QA, and support of any. NET-based technology.
Pollux’s Competencies on Microsoft’s .NET framework
Pollux has created internal Microsoft Competency Center for .NET located at our
Development Center, which serves as the hub of all .NET related development activities
in the company. This initiative helps in offering leading-edge technology solutions
to the customers across the globe. The center is equipped with the .NET servers,
tools and technologies. It is also equipped with e-learning tools to impart training
to employees.
The center has a .NET ready trainer who pioneers the development of talent around
.NET Architecture with special focus on mobility, workflow, high availability and
business intelligence. Pollux also has a small but dedicated Microsoft .NET R&D
team. Their responsibility is to research the latest releases, get acquainted with
the latest technologies and share knowledge with the rest of the team.
Members of this group and other software developers attend internal training sessions
and technical seminars organized by various technical user groups. Pollux currently
has 20 .NET developers and architects and plan on adding 20 additional Software
Architects and developers on the .NET framework by the end of the year.
Advantages .NET [
There are several reasons to be interested in .NET, including the following: ]
 |
Fewer Development Paradigms To Learn.
Office macro development requires you to learn a development paradigm using Visual
Basic for Applications (VBA). Web application development requires you to learn
another development paradigm using a different set of development languages, such
as Microsoft Visual Basic Scripting Edition (VBScript) or Microsoft JScript®. If
you need to call the Microsoft Windows® application programming interface (API),
you have to learn yet another development paradigm. Microsoft .NET consists of one
development paradigm for both desktop and Web-based applications, which reduces
the number of new Microsoft development technologies you need to learn.
|
 |
Easier And Faster Application Deployment.
One big frustration for Office developers is application deployment and versioning.
If you ask an Office developer about distributing macros, deploying Microsoft Outlook®
Forms, registering dynamic-link libraries (DLLs), or updating Component Object Model
(COM) add-ins, you are bound to get complaints. For many .NET applications, .NET
features "copy and paste" or XCOPY deployment (users simply copy your application
files from the source media to any single directory and run the application). Finally,
.NET no longer relies on the Windows registry or regsvr32.exe, which eliminates
DLL and COM add-in version compatibility issues. |
 |
New Types Of Office Solutions.
Office VBA solutions development is currently restricted to macros, UserForms, or
Outlook Forms applications, and Web projects such as data access pages, Microsoft
FrontPage® Web sites, applications interacting with the Microsoft Office Web Components,
and static HTML pages. Office VBA has made advances into the .NET world by integrating
with XML Web services
through the SOAP Toolkit, as well as integrating with the
Microsoft Windows
Server System™, such as Microsoft Exchange Server, Microsoft SQL
Server™, and Microsoft BizTalk™ Server. However, additional types of applications
in .NET include richer desktop-based applications with custom user controls, Web
form–based applications with custom Web controls, .NET Framework class libraries,
command-line applications, and Windows background services. In the years ahead,
Visual Basic .NET will also be the language of choice for Office developers to create
digital dashboard solutions, solutions based on SharePoint™ Team Services and SharePoint
Portal Server, Web Parts, smart tags, XML-based solutions, and more. |
|